Few days later, I decided to introduce Mo to the other dogs, to create a bond. I have two other dogs by the way. "Coco" the cross breed, and "bella" the mongrel, both female. Bella the mongrel, sniffed mo and all of a sudden started to run like Jim Iyke during his deliverance at T.B joshua's synagogue. Mo chased her round the compound like a relay race. Maybe bella was possessed and Mo has healing powers ![]() Later it was Coco the cross breed dog's turn. Now this part was a bit tricky, Coco is three times or more the size of Mo and very aggressive. She could do serious damage or worse to Mo if she wanted to. I had to take precautions and monitor them closely just in case Coco decides to act funny. Coco sniffed Mo and surprisingly started to lick her ears to clean the dirt. "This is the beginning of a beautiful friendship" I thought to myself. Minutes later, the worse happened, she was bitten! Over and over again. I just stood there and watched. I mean Coco the cross breed was bitten by Mo. All Coco could do was try to run away. I locked the exit to prevent Coco from escaping the "biting session". Why? Because I thought it was funny at the time. I know, I'm a terrible person. For the record I get bitten by Mo daily, her bites are not that painful. okay I lied, It was hella painful. But hey, what doesn't kill you makes you stronger eh? PS: Coco still licks Mo's ears to clean the dirt till this day. ![]()

It was her first night, so I put her in a crate. I laid in bed, ready to sleep after a very long day. I turned off the lights and then it started, "the whinning and crying". Turned on the lights to check if everything was fine, nothing was wrong. So I went back to bed. Immediately I turned off the lights, it all started again. She cried, whined,cried and cried some more. After trying everything I could, even sleeping with the lights on didn't help. The only reasonable option left was to put her on my bed, which I did. Finally! the whinning stopped. I laid in bed and she slept close to my legs. Luckily for her, I don't kick while I sleep... I think. Funny part is whenever I leave my bed she immediately gets up too I tried to sneak out of bed in the morning because I didn't want to wake her up. I got outta bed, turned back to look at her and there she was, staring at me with that "bros where you think say you dey go?" Look. Plus you gotta love her "crouching tiger hidden dragon" sleeping position. ![]()
